How to progress from the Dublin Photography School to Fetac level 5 & 6 Photography Courses
We at the Dublin Photography School are delighted to announce that Saint Kevin’s Photography & Media College are now recognising our photography courses and workshops with RPL accreditation

Saint Kevin’s College which is based in Crumlin, is and has been one of the leading providers of FETAC levels 5 & 6 photography and media courses in Dublin for over 25 years.



FAQ’s

Does this mean I will have automatic access to a place on a FETAC course in Saint Kevin’s College?

No. It means that when applying for a place in Saint Kevin’s College that the course is recognised as appropriate or recognised prior learning and will go towards your overall application.

How will the admission officers in Saint Kevin’s College know that I have completed a course/workshop with the Dublin Photography School?

The Dublin Photography School will issue a certificate (upon request) detailing the photography courses/workshops that you have completed with them.

Do all courses provided by the Dublin Photography School have RPL accreditation with Saint Kevin’s college?

At the moment all of the weekly part time photography courses are recognised, i.e. 7 week/5 week introduction DSLR courses and studio courses, 5 week follow on courses and workshops etc. As of yet all the photography holidays with Travel Department, location shoots, photo walks and excursions are not recognised.
